About the League's Nonpartisan Advocacy

The League is a non-partisan political organization. We have a long history of creating social change through advocacy. While we neither support nor oppose political parties or candidates, we do study issues and take positions that support action. The state League uses national and state positions to advocate on legislation, ballot measures, regulations, and on matters before state boards and commissions.
